Note: 1: … WebThe first family listed in Figure 23.2. 1 is the hydrocarbons. These include alkanes, with the general molecular formula C n H 2n+2 where n is an integer; alkenes, represented by C n H 2n; alkynes, represented by C n H 2n−2; and arenes. WebFeb 3, 2015 · The predominant meaning of "to cotton" is to like something.Cotton on to, meaning to understand, grasp, was colloquial in the early 1900s. (OED) Besides its usual sense as a noun for the plant used to make cloth, cotton is also a verb meaning to get along with, to like.. It's been used since 1488, but didn't take on it's meaning of being in harmony …
